centos

CentOS PHP日志中的数据库查询如何优化

小樊
42
2025-12-19 15:27:44
栏目: 编程语言

在 CentOS 系统上优化 PHP 日志中的数据库查询,可以从以下几个方面入手:

1. 分析慢查询日志

首先,启用并分析 MySQL 的慢查询日志,找出执行时间较长的 SQL 语句。

2. 优化 SQL 查询

根据慢查询日志中的信息,优化 SQL 查询语句。

3. 优化数据库配置

调整 MySQL 的配置参数,以适应应用的需求。

4. 优化 PHP 代码

优化 PHP 代码,减少不必要的数据库查询。

5. 监控和调优

持续监控数据库性能,定期进行调优。

示例:优化 SQL 查询

假设有一个慢查询:

SELECT * FROM users WHERE age > 30;

可以通过添加索引来优化:

CREATE INDEX idx_age ON users(age);

然后再次使用 EXPLAIN 分析查询计划:

EXPLAIN SELECT * FROM users WHERE age > 30;

通过以上步骤,可以有效地优化 CentOS 系统上 PHP 日志中的数据库查询,提高应用性能。

0
看了该问题的人还看了